When Should I Replace My Roof in Des Plaines?
When you should replace your roof varies depending on its roofing material and which area your Des Plaines home is in, but there are a few indicators you should pay attention to in order to help you determine when it's time to replace your roof. A sign that you might want to replace your roof is recurring leaks or extensive damage that's too severe to be repaired.
Some homeowners in Des Plaines are thinking about going solar. You may want to replace your roof before installing solar panels, however, since you'll want it to last longer than your solar panels.
